Can anyone recommend some decent skinny jeans?

My fav at the moment are probably the top shop Leigh jeans although I find the black fades so quickly.

Oasis jeans I feel are a little thick and go baggy round the knees.

Warehouse jeans I quite like but usually a bit long for me.

I’m 5’5 ish and a size of 10

RhiannonOHara · 12/01/2018 12:42

Uniqlo Ultra-Stretch. Reasonably priced, good long legs (I'm a 34" inside leg so this is like the holy grail for me), not too low-riding so no muffin top. I wash and wear mine all the time and they keep their shape and their stretch beautifully. There's enough stretch that they're very comfortable too.

rightknockered · 14/01/2018 10:57

I have a problem with my thighs. They are apparently out of proportion with the rest of me, but I don't think they're big Confused. My thighs measure 19 inches at their fattest, and my waist is 24. If I buy 24 inch jeans, they are very tight on my thighs, whereas a 26 fits my thighs but too big around waist and stomach. I really would love to find some made for thin women that have curves. Retailers seem to think that with a smaller waist size comes no curves, and I doubt I'm alone with this problem.

With the jeans that slip down, I take them to the tailor and get the tailer to make darts along the waistband to make the waistband tighter, kind of like an invisible belt. It stops them slipping down. A few times lately if I went down a size I felt like they were sprayed on but the right size slips down and it's so annoying.
